Arshad Warsi Exclusive: Saying yes to the role of ‘Circuit’ was a difficult phase of his/her career.

Arshad Warsi will soon be seen in the film ‘Banda Singh Chaudhary’. While talking to presswire18times.com he/she told why he/she does less films. he/she also revealed that he/she had saved someone from drowning in real life. Know what was said about Prabhas’ statement.

Arshad Warsi, who won the hearts of the audience with his/her comic roles on screen, has been in Bollywood for more than two and a half decades. he/she also played many intense characters, but his/her laughing image has remained firm in the minds of the audience. Arshad, who wants to do Basu Chatterjee type light comedy, is in the news these days with his/her new film ‘Banda Singh Chaudhary’, in which he/she will be seen in a new avatar. Your new film is a story of courage, have you done anything courageous in real life?
-Many times. One happened on the sets of ‘Golmaal’. We were shooting on jet skis in Bangkok. I am an expert in jet ski driving and the other day I was taking my crew for a jet ski round in the ocean. My cameraman said, Sir, do the skit you were doing. I told him/her that the skit was very risky, but he/she started insisting a lot. I did that skit, but during that time the cameraman lost his/her grip and he/she flew off the jet ski and fell into the water, but he/she also made me fall into the water.

Arshad Warsi saved his/her life
Arshad said, ‘Both of us were inside the water and the jet skis were separate and the shore was so far that people looked like ants, the scary thing about that was that the cameraman did not know how to swim. I swam to the surface, but I could not see this man. Now whether I should go towards the jet ski or go into the water to save him/her, I did not think even for a second and became courageous and went to save him/her. To tell you the truth, when I was carrying it from under the water, I thought that we would not be able to escape because it weighed a lot and the strong waves were cutting us. I was about to pass out from exhaustion and the game was about to end when a crew member noticed that we were not on a jet ski and came towards us. Do you know what was the funny thing? After saving him/her, when we reached the shore, he/she looked towards the sky and said, God saved me. I said, Hey I saved you. (Laughs loudly) God was drowning you.

What was the difficult phase of your career?
-I have never told this to anyone till date, but I am saying it today. The circuit role phase of ‘Munna Bhai MBBS’ was the most difficult phase of my career, because till then I was playing the first or second lead in films and the role given to me in ‘Munna Bhai’ was that of a goon. Which was, in a way, one of the five mustangs of the hero. At that time it was very difficult for me to agree to that role, but after that role everything changed. That small role on the circuit became iconic.
